Prediction markets arrive in Spain. Hypermind, the leading European tool for collective intelligence, and beBartlet, the Spanish public affairs consultancy, announced yesterday at the Mobile World Congress a partnership to use this tool exclusively in the field of strategic consulting across Europe. This technology, used by European governments to make better decisions, enables organizations, companies, or media outlets to aggregate intelligence to anticipate scenarios and make smarter decisions.

He has spent 25 years driving the main European project for prediction markets. How did it begin?
I started when I worked as a journalist. My family is from Germany. My father created L’Express, my grandfather created Les Echos, and my uncle created L’Expansion. It is a family of journalists. But I was never a journalist: I was a scientist. I studied the brain — cognitive science —, and did a PhD in cognitive science at Carnegie Mellon. I began my career as an artificial intelligence engineer in the nineties, during the so-called “AI winter.” At that time, everyone thought we were clowns.
Then, over time, I became a journalist to seek new ideas in a scientific magazine. I came across an article proposing this idea: instead of using AI to track the Internet and see what’s happening — thirteen years ago the technology wasn’t there to do what we do today —, instead of using AI agents to search for information on the web, perhaps we could use brains connected to the web to generate collective intelligence, especially about the future, which is the hardest problem.
“I thought about creating platforms where people bet against each other to make predictions about the future, and the collective intelligence would be greater than that of any individual”
That was the first time you could massively connect many human brains and see what that network of brains could do. Before the web, this was impossible. As a scientist and as someone who has studied the brain, I knew that all intelligence is based on collective interactions of many smaller agents that aren’t as smart. Neurons, for example: there are 80 billion neurons in your brain. When it became possible to tap the network of human brains created by the web, I thought: “This is fantastic.”
Then I thought of creating platforms where people bet against each other to make predictions about the future, and the collective intelligence would be greater than that of any individual. As a scientist, I was interested in that possibility. As a journalist, I was interested in another thing: we spend time offering analyses and news and making people smarter. That is your craft: to make people smarter. But you don’t do anything with it. Maybe they receive a letter to the editor or something, but little else.
So we give them information through the media and they return to us, through this prediction platform, the use of tomorrow.
Isn’t it enough that people can be smarter?
No, because if you create something valuable and you do not use that value, it is a waste. You make people smarter, and what do you get? A bit of money and perhaps a bit of influence. But you do not obtain the possibility to use that intelligence at your disposal to make yourself smarter, or for your organization or your newspaper to be more effective.
Imagine you are aware of everything your readers know and all the analysis they are capable of doing. How much value would it bring to your media organization to be able to leverage it? There was a famous Hewlett-Packard CEO in the nineties, at the start of the knowledge-management revolution within organizations. He said: “If HP knew what HP knows.” There is a lot of knowledge out there, but you do not have a way to aggregate it and make it useful.
That was the idea: we give the news and they return predictions about what will happen next. What will happen with Trump’s Peace Board? How many countries will join? That will be tomorrow’s news, so we can have it today.

Perhaps some readers aren’t familiar with prediction markets and might think they are similar. What is the difference between prediction markets and surveys or polls?
It is completely different. It’s important to realize that surveys and polls were invented less than 100 years ago: in 1936, by Gallup. Before that, do you think people didn’t make predictions about elections?
No…
Betting is probably the second oldest profession in the world. We have records of fifteen presidential elections before Gallup invented surveys, in which people bet on Wall Street about who would be the next president. Essentially, they were running prediction markets in the street rather than on the Internet.
The scientific record of those elections before surveys shows that the favorites in betting markets won fourteen out of fifteen times. It was quite accurate. In fact, when surveys arrived, people thought: “Finally, something scientific to predict elections.” Yet history shows that surveys did not do better in accuracy than betting markets before they existed.
Not only that: since surveys were invented, betting markets became less efficient because they were contaminated by bad surveys. As we’ve seen in many elections, people look at a poll and say: “This is what will happen, so I’m going to bet accordingly.” Then, when Donald Trump is elected instead of Hillary Clinton, everyone is surprised. Also, we have newspaper records, for example the New York Post, from before polls. What did they publish? Instead of polls, the odds that Roosevelt would win. Five to one that Roosevelt wins, and then it rises compared to the previous week. They treated betting markets exactly the same way polls are used today as content.
The second difference is the foundation. Polls are based on a representative sample of the population. If you want to say Spaniards prefer this candidate or that one, you need to ensure you represent every Spaniard with a probability of voting. Representativeness is the central principle.

In betting markets, representativeness does not matter. What matters is knowledge. That’s why we seek to recruit people who know politics, are interested, and absorb new information all the time to act accordingly. No one is perfect. Everyone has biases: if you are left or right, you may not necessarily have the same perspective or consume the same information. But here you are not asked to express a preference: you are asked to express a prediction. We do not appeal to your emotions. In fact, we observe that betting dampens the brain region linked to emotion, while the area associated with rational thinking is more activated. You are asked for a forecast of what will actually happen on the ground. You must empathize with reality, not with ideology.

What incentive do people have to participate in a prediction market?
There are four types of incentives, depending on what you want to achieve.
One: rewards. The money you could win or the prizes you could obtain.
Two: recognition. For example, inside Google, when there is a prediction market, not about politics but about the number of Gmail failures, people don’t care about the money: they’re well paid. They care about recognition, such as a T-shirt that says: “I am the best forecaster at Google.” It’s a form of social recognition within the company.
Three: relationships. When you bet against others, you get to know each other. It’s a social activity: you enjoy a community of predictors who compete to see who is the best. You bargain about the correct price for Trump to win the next election, or for Sánchez to stay in power, whatever it may be.

Four: relevance. If I read an article in about the European automotive market and electric vehicles, and I’m truly interested in that industry, I have ideas about what could happen, what should happen, or what will likely happen. Prediction platforms give me a channel to express it. That relevance, whether for work or personal interest, consists of being able to express my ideas there. If not, I could only discuss them with my friends.
What real influence could prediction markets have?
In politics they can have as much influence as polls, perhaps more, because polls are a weak technology. That’s why there exist aggregators: because no single poll is reliable enough. Moreover, it is not transparent. Each pollster has its own formula, and that formula is as secret as the Coca‑Cola recipe. You cannot fully trust it, because we know that some polls favor the right, others the left, and yet they influence.
For example, the New York Times reported that most Americans did not like what Trump did in his first year. Do you believe it? It would not be the same if it came from Fox News. In the last election, the prediction market, two weeks earlier, began to favor Trump, surprisingly, because polls showed a tie for three weeks. No one could differentiate.
There was some manipulation that worked. It gave Trump a psychological edge that could have made the difference in a very tight election, which he won by a few votes. Prediction markets can influence in this way.
However, that is not the influence I’m most interested in. I’m drawn to how prediction markets can quantify the future so that people, especially companies and policymakers, have a better sense of risks. Politicians often decide based on ideology rather than reality. In response, prediction markets offer a gamified way to consult what people on the ground think will happen. I find it a powerful way to choose policies to achieve concrete objectives.

Prediction markets and artificial intelligence: do we perhaps no longer need people to make predictions?
Let me explain. We have just created a purely artificial forecasting machine based on AI: The Forecasting Machine. It is very interesting. A year ago it wasn’t feasible, but now AI can make predictions as well as a diverse crowd of intelligent humans. In six months or a year, AI will be better; in two years, significantly better.
The main advantage is that AI does not need rewards. It does not care about making a prediction for tomorrow or for a hundred years from now: it takes all predictions seriously. It is faster, about a hundred times faster than humans, and cheaper — much cheaper. So why do we still need human forecasters? For reasons and applications that differ. If you want to do horizon scanning around your company, AI can do it. But if you want to involve people, because humans still live on the planet and you need to organize them into movements, you need human forecasters.

Getting people to think about the future is a way to make them smarter today. You cannot be smart about the present if you do not think about tomorrow: environment, global peace, inequality, or social organization. The best way is to gamify the effort, because thinking about the future is very hard. Most people do not spend much time thinking about the future, and that is a problem for them and for the community.
Right now we have a predictions project about the war in Ukraine called Glimt.nu. It is part of Swedish government aid to Ukraine. The idea is to contribute not with tanks or weapons, but with intelligence.
Ukrainian analysts raise questions that worry them, and we created a prediction-market platform with the Swedish Ministry of Defense to invite Europeans, now many Swedes and French, and hopefully some Spaniards as well, to respond.
The questions include the economy of the war, Russian assets in Brussels, Russian inflation, flows of oil through the shadow fleet. Also military questions: how many missiles will hit Kyiv, which city will fall next… And political questions: whether there will be a new US aid package, what will happen with Russian assets, or who will be elected in Poland or Hungary.
The idea is that the wisdom of a multitude of European citizens, all interested in Ukraine, can contribute analysis from their perspectives. Those diverse perspectives combine and are delivered to Ukrainian analysts. It is not about asking the AI: it is about involving Europeans to stay informed and engaged.
You have mentioned intelligence agencies. How could prediction markets change the way they work? It seems like a big change…
They were the first natural clients. In the United States there is an agency called IARPA, Intelligence Advanced Research Projects Agency. About fifteen years ago they started a multi-year project to test whether crowd predictions could be useful for geopolitics.
Instead of Ukrainians, the CIA posed a hundred questions a year to anyone interested, including readers of the New York Times, Foreign Policy, and other enthusiasts.
They compared forecasts from 10,000 diverse enthusiasts with the predictions of intelligence analysts: the same accuracy, but much cheaper. Within that crowd, around 2% were exceptional: about 30% better than analysts, and they charged only two hundred dollars a year. Incredible.

Is the CIA worried about this?
No, it is complementary. If it is cheaper, you give them a badge that says “recognized super forecaster” (prestigious super-forecaster). They put it on LinkedIn and they become more valuable. You create forecasting competitions and recognize talent.
These superforecasters have experience in many domains: geopolitics, sports, economics, business. They know how to break down a problem analytically and recombine it. We know how they think thanks to the Good Judgment Project. We can even teach AI to think like a super forecaster, although humans can still be better for one or two more years.

How do you see the relationship between prediction markets and journalism?
No one would read a financial newspaper if there were no stock market: it would be boring. If you want to operate in the market, you need to read the newspaper to inform yourself. The market exists, so the newspaper exists.
I think the future of journalism will depend on gamifying the news. For example, Polymarket partners with The Wall Street Journal: people need the news to predict market results.
The business model of Polymarket makes money from the players: it is a betting platform. Another model we use allows the audience of a publication to play, creating a community. Companies can buy access to insights from that community instead of merely advertising.
Is this about engagement?
Exactly. The audience is an intelligence asset. If we can add it, we can monetize it. There are many companies that would pay for those insights. Instead of just placing ads, you gain real predictive intelligence.
